Measurement
target |
Positive and negative
electrode sheets for rechargeable lithium-ion batteries |
Measurement parameters |
Composite
resistivity [Ωcm] |
|
Interface
resistance (contact resistance) between the composite layer and current
collector [Ωcm^2] |
Computation method |
Inverse
problem analysis of potential distribution using the finite volume method |
